Artistic Freedom

Journal Entry: Sat Aug 18, 2007, 6:44 PM
I am not going to rant about Deviant Art here, because this is my Deviant Art journal, and I am using the services they provide me, free of charge. When one signs up for Deviant Art one agrees to all the terms and conditions outlined in the TOS (Terms of Service) and the rules and regulations. That's just the way it is.

They could have something therein that states 'all females over the age of fifteen must wear a purple hat every Wednesday, take a picture of themselves in said hat, and post it to their Deviant Art account'. If we wanted to use the Deviant Art service, we would have to agree to that term, and would do so when we checked the box indicating that we agreed to the TOS. If all females over the age of fifteen did not comply with the aforementioned rule, Deviant Art would be well within their rights to ban or suspend said person.

I understand this. Sadly, I think that the banning, removal of images and suspensions taking place on Deviant Art are not so much happening because someone has violated something in the rules or the TOS, but rather, that someone has violated someone else's sensibilities.

It seems that these days Deviant Art (and maybe people in general) are more concerned with not offending anyone, being politically correct, and keeping the masses happy as opposed to what may actually count as grounds to not have a piece of art seen over the internet.

It's rumored that there are admins and others on Deviant Art who watch and target specific users, lying in wait for a piece of art that may upset or offend. It's said that they remove that piece of art, sending a note to the artist in the form of a generic letter stating that that artist's image may or may not have contained any number of various things that were either, in violation of the law or the Deviant Art TOS. That letter also goes on to say that even if the image didn't contain any of the above mentioned things, it may still -- for reasons never made clear to the artist -- violate the TOS or the law in general.

I don't know if this is true or not, and I would hope it not to be. Just thinking that it may be makes it a sad day for art in general.

To you, the reader of this journal, I pose some questions -- some things that really should be thought about by all who delve into the 'art online' world, including, but not limited to Deviant Art. After all, the internet is a powerful media, for art and all things. It is not going away, nor shrinking. Online art and online art hosting websites are only growing and here to stay. I think that's great, but I also think that it warrants a particular responsibility on the part of the hosting website and its staff.

This responsibility is not about what may offend, upset or what young eyes shouldn't see. It's about the truth in art – all manor of art from images to sculpture to written verse. It’s about respect to art, artists and the history and struggle for artistic freedom and expression. It’s about not playing favorites or ‘targeting’ those who may post art that is strange, risqué or offensive, but embracing the message behind and within the piece.

I ask you all:

At what point did art stop being about expression and start having to be politically correct?

If someone is offended by a piece of art, or it's naughty or racy, does that mean that it shouldn't be shown?

Though Deviant Art is a service we all are using, should they be allowed to ' police ' the artwork on the site based on their whims, offering generic notes to artists as to why a piece has been removed?

Shouldn't those in power be fair to everyone, and not allow one person to post a graphic nude image with no consequences, while coming down on someone else who they've 'targeted' for posting a suggestive image because the former is a photographic piece, while the latter is digital art?

Should we - as artists - be given more rights and respect?
